Dumpsites in Lagos raise the contamination of the environment. This study aimed to determine radon exhalation rates and their changes with meteorological parameters on six dumpsites using the accumulation method. The result uncovers the critical relationship between radon concentration and relative humidity at a 5% (p < 0.05) level. Radon exhalation rates varied between 20 and 50 mBq− 2 h− 1. This study is an illustrative map and an essential reference for studying the pollution from radon gas and its impact on the region’s residents, especially as it poses a threat to their health.
